Cafe Lolo Santa Rosa, CA
This place is great. The menu consists of your typical "California Cuisine." We started with the Ceasar salad (split) and it was good, but not special. I had the swordfish with fruit salsa & french fried shoe string potatoes, my date had the Sonoma County chicken on mash potatoes with vegetables. Both dishes were prepared to perfection, the swordfish being a tastier dish IMHO. The wine list is QUITE extensive, with both European (Italian & French) as well as American wines. Wine prices are quite varied, with a low of $19, and a high of around $100. We followed dinner with an excellent and bountiful Creme Brulle' and topped it all off with a glass of Taylor Fladgate 20 year old port. Service was impeccable. Recommendations HIGHLY recommended. All forms of dress acceptable, from jeans to formal dress. (typical California "formal")

Nan Yang Rockridge Oakland, CA
An excellent restaraunt. For those of you tired of the usual chinese style meal, try this place. The garlic noodles are spectacular. The wine list is small, but the selections are above average. The somosas are mediocre, the hot & sour soup is HOT but very good (try the Zinfandel with the soup), the Green Papaya salad is quite good.
